Ticket: Config drift on ReminderLoop job (Braywell Clinic scheduler). Welcome aboard — please read carefully before touching anything. The appointment reminder job in staging is sending SMS batches two hours earlier than production, and we traced it to hand-edited values on the staging host that were never committed back to the Quillhaven config repo. Do not reconcile by copying production blindly; some staging overrides are intentional. The values currently live on the staging host are as follows.

config for kafof-bawef:
holath:
  log_level: debug
  metrics_host: metrics.holath.qorvelsys.internal
  pin: 2191
  pool_size: 32

Runbook: Scanline barcode bridge

If warehouse scans stop flowing into Cartwheel, it's almost always the bridge service on the Dunmore floor box wedging after a USB hiccup. Bounce the service first — nine times out of ten that fixes it. If not, check the queue depth before escalating. When restarting, make sure the bridge comes up with these settings.

deployment values, yafop-bajef:
[gilok]
team = ulaius
access_code = ac_423664
host = gilok.sivrelhq.corp
port = 9200
owner = pelius.istax
peer = eliok.torvasoft.internal

# Approvals: Undo/Redo in Fernline Diagram Editor

Changes to the command-stack module require approval before merge. The undo/redo history is serialized per canvas, so any modification to command granularity or snapshot boundaries can corrupt saved sessions. Reviewers should verify round-trip tests pass on the Oakhurst fixture set. Final approval authority for this module rests with the person named below.

approver of bagug-bagag = Holael Pramir